Bpifrance

Bpifrance is a financial institution dedicated to supporting companies throughout their development stages, particularly those preparing for stock market listing and seeking credit equity. The organization provides a range of financial solutions, including financing, innovation assistance, and capital investment. By integrating various entities such as OSEO and CDC Entreprises, Bpifrance aims to deliver tailored financial support that addresses the specific needs of businesses. The institution is committed to fostering innovation and helping companies transition toward sustainable growth, ensuring they are well-equipped to face future challenges.

DCbrain

Venture Round in 2022
DCbrain is a deep-tech SaaS company based in Paris, France, founded in 2014. It specializes in providing an AI-powered optimization platform aimed primarily at the energy and supply chain sectors. The company's solution utilizes graph models and machine learning to enhance the exploitation and maintenance processes of complex industrial networks, including gas, water, electricity, and logistics. By integrating a visualization interface with predictive analysis tools, DCbrain enables clients to identify anomalies, prevent incidents, and forecast future developments within their networks. This sophisticated approach helps organizations manage their operations efficiently and effectively.

Pixyl

Venture Round in 2021
Pixyl is a company specializing in a neuroimaging cloud platform aimed at enhancing patient care for radiologists and clinicians. Its platform, Pixyl.Neuro, utilizes advanced machine learning techniques to automatically analyze MRI images, providing critical information on brain structures such as grey matter, white matter, and intracranial volumes. This technology enables the extraction of neuroimaging biomarkers, facilitating improved insights and decision-making in both clinical studies and routine practice. By seamlessly integrating into the workflows of imaging contract research organizations, neuroradiologists, and neurologists, Pixyl supports data-driven and value-based patient care, particularly for conditions such as multiple sclerosis, stroke, and neurodegenerative diseases.

Delair

Series A in 2016
Delair is a prominent provider of visual intelligence solutions that help enterprises capture, manage, and analyze their assets. Founded in 2011 by aerospace industry experts, the company combines high-performance un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) hardware with its advanced platform, delair.ai, to facilitate a comprehensive visual intelligence workflow that includes data management and analytics. Delair's solutions are utilized across more than 70 countries and are supported by a network of over 100 resellers in various industries, including mining, construction, agriculture, oil and gas, utilities, and transportation. The company has enhanced its market position through strategic acquisitions and investments, employing approximately 180 people with offices located in Toulouse, Paris, Los Angeles, and Singapore.

GeoConcept

Series C in 2012
Founded in 1990, GeoConcept Group specializes in developing cartographic optimization technologies for professional applications. The company is recognized as a leader in the field of cartographic information and optimization solutions for both corporate and public sector use. By integrating its proprietary Geographic Information System (GIS) with optimization tools, GeoConcept has pioneered the concept of "geo-optimization," which enhances operational efficiency by leveraging geographical data. Its software applications are utilized in various domains, including geomarketing, territory management, crisis management, and mobile workforce management, thus enabling organizations to make informed decisions and streamline their activities across multiple sectors such as transport, logistics, and sales.
